Planning a trip to Sri Lanka and want a budget-friendly way to get around? Consider renting a tuk tuk! These iconic three-wheeled vehicles are popular throughout the country, offering a fun and memorable experience. But how much does it actually cost?
Tuk tuk rental prices in Sri Lanka fluctuate on several factors, including the period of your rental, the type of tuk tuk you choose, and your negotiating skills. Generally, you can expect to pay somewhere between LKR 1,500 to LKR 3,000 daily.
- Remember that these are just general guidelines, and it's always best to negotiate directly with the tuk tuk owner.
- Factor any additional fees such as fuel, parking, or insurance.

Hop on a Tuk Tuk: Your Guide to Sri Lankan Transport Costs
Riding in a tuk tuk is one of the most fun ways to get around Sri Lanka. These more info colorful three-wheeled vehicles are everywhere and offer a unique viewpoint of the country. But before you hop in, it's important to be aware of how much a tuk tuk ride will cost.
Prices for tuk tuks can vary depending on several aspects, such as the length of your trip, the time of day, and the bargaining skills of both parties. It's always best to set a fare before you start your journey. You can ask locals for an idea of what a fair price would be.
- Here are some tips for negotiating tuk tuk fares in Sri Lanka::
- Be respectful but firm when negotiating.
- Establish a set price at the beginning of your trip..
- If the price seems too high, consider finding another tuk tuk..
